什么是ssl
什么是SSL
SSL(Secure Sockets Layer)是一种安全协议,用于保护网络通信的安全性。它是在网络上进行加密和解密的过程中,确保数据传输的安全性和完整性。
SSL的工作原理
SSL的工作原理可以分为以下几个步骤:
- 客户端向服务器发送请求,请求建立SSL连接。
- 服务器将自己的证书发送给客户端。
- 客户端验证证书是否可信,如果可信则生成随机数并使用服务器的公钥加密。
- 服务器使用自己的私钥解密客户端发送的数据,并使用客户端的随机数和服务器的随机数生成对称密钥。
- 服务器将对称密钥发送给客户端,客户端使用对称密钥加密数据并发送给服务器。
- 服务器使用对称密钥解密数据并进行处理。
- SSL连接建立成功,客户端和服务器之间的通信变为安全加密的状态。
SSL的作用
SSL的作用主要有以下几个方面:
- 保护数据的安全性:通过SSL协议加密数据,可以防止黑客窃取数据。
- 保护数据的完整性:通过SSL协议校验数据的完整性,可以防止黑客篡改数据。
- 证明身份的真实性:通过SSL证书,可以证明服务器的身份真实性,防止黑客伪造服务器。
- 提高网站的信誉度:通过使用SSL证书,可以提高网站在用户心中的信誉度,增强用户对网站的信任感。
上一篇:什么太阳能热水器好